Why clear goals are crucial

Without a goal, there's no path – this is especially true if you want to achieve your bikini body in the new year. Clear goals give you direction and make progress visible. So-called SMART goals help with this: they are spec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ound. For example: "Lose 5 kg by June" or "Exercise three times a week."

Measurable successes motivate you to stick with it. Studies show that goal-oriented people maintain routines for longer. Visualize your goals regularly, for example with a vision board or an app, to stay focused. You can learn more about this in the SMART method for goal setting .

Basics of a balanced diet

To make your bikini body a reality in the new year, you need the right mix of proteins, carbohydrates, and fats. Proteins support muscle maintenance and keep you feeling full, while complex carbohydrates provide energy. Healthy fats, like those found in avocados or nuts, promote hormonal balance.

Micronutrients such as vitamins and minerals are also essential. They ensure performance and strengthen your immune system. A sample daily plan could look like this:

Have a good meal Example
Breakfast Oatmeal with berries and yogurt
snack handful of almonds
Lunch Quinoa bowl with chicken and vegetables
snack Greek yogurt with fruit
Dinner Salmon fillet with broccoli and sweet potato

The selection is diverse and can be customized to individual needs.

Calorie deficit and healthy weight loss

To achieve your bikini body in the new year, a gentle calorie deficit is crucial. This means you burn more calories than you consume. You calculate your individual calorie goal based on your basal metabolic rate, activity level, and goals.

A healthy weight loss rate is 0.5 to 1 kg per week. Studies show that crash diets, while they can produce quick results, often lead to the yo-yo effect. Instead, focus on sustainable strategies and treat yourself to small rewards now and then. Visualizing your progress provides extra motivation.

Hydration and metabolism booster

Optimal hydration is essential for a bikini-ready figure in the new year. At least 2 to 3 liters of water per day are recommended. Water not only aids metabolism but also promotes a feeling of fullness.

Green tea and coffee can also give your metabolism a slight boost, as long as you consume them in moderation. Many myths surround detox diets, but the benefits of consistent hydration and natural foods are scientifically proven. Stick to simple and tried-and-tested methods.

Dietary supplements – useful or not?

Many people who want to optimize their bikini body in the new year wonder whether supplements are necessary. Generally speaking, those who eat a balanced diet usually don't need supplements. In some cases – for example, vitamin D in winter or omega-3 if you don't eat much fish – they can be beneficial.

Be wary of diet pills or supposed "miracle cures." Experts recommend focusing on natural, unprocessed foods. Supplements are only beneficial if there is a genuine deficiency or if you are pursuing a specific goal.

Strength training for a toned physique

Strength training is key to getting your bikini body ready for the new year and effectively burning fat. Muscle not only creates a toned physique but also increases your basal metabolic rate, meaning you burn more calories even at rest.

Beginners benefit from simple full-body workouts that can be done both at home and in the gym:

  • Squats
  • push-ups
  • Rowing with dumbbells

Example 3-day strength training plan:

day focus Exercises
Monday Full body Squats, plank, shoulder press
Wednesday Lower body Lunges, hip thrusts, calf raises
Friday upper body Push-ups, rowing, tricep dips

Regular strength training will lay the foundation for your bikini body in the new year.

Cardio training and HIIT

Cardio and HIIT are both effective ways to maximize fat burning for your bikini body in the new year. While classic cardio like jogging or cycling improves endurance, HIIT scores points with short, intense intervals and high calorie expenditure.

The difference: Cardio is more consistent, while HIIT alternates between exertion and rest. Studies show that HIIT burns up to 30 percent more calories. You can find a detailed comparison under HIIT vs. classic cardio .

Tip: Start with HIIT twice a week and cardio once a week. This will keep your training varied and motivating for getting in bikini shape in the new year.

Regeneration and sleep

Recovery is an underestimated factor on the road to a bikini body in the new year. Only with sufficient regeneration can your body build muscle and burn fat.

Pay attention to:

  • 7–8 hours of sleep per night
  • Relaxation phases after training
  • Light exercise on rest days, e.g. walks

Tips for better sleep: Regular bedtimes, no screens before bed, and a quiet environment. Your body will thank you, and your bikini body in the new year will benefit.

Sustainable swimwear: Environmentally conscious and stylish

Sustainability is playing an increasingly important role in bikini body design this year. More and more brands are focusing on recycled fabrics, innovative fibers, and fair production conditions. This conserves resources and ensures a good feeling when wearing swimwear. The advantages of sustainable swimwear include not only environmental protection but also a comfortable feel and skin-friendliness. Models made from Econyl or recycled polyester are particularly popular. Labels with a focus on sustainability also pay attention to pollutant-free dyes and durable quality, so you can be stylish and responsible with your bikini body this year.

Do I have to give up everything to achieve a bikini body?

No, getting a bikini body in the new year doesn't require complete deprivation. A flexible diet is key: Use the 80/20 rule. 80% of your diet should be balanced and healthy, while 20% can be for indulgence.

This way you avoid cravings and stay motivated in the long run. Even small indulgences fit into the plan, as long as you maintain balance.

What alternatives are there if I have little time?

You don't need to train for hours to get in bikini shape for the new year. Short, effective workouts like HIIT or circuit training can be completed in 20 minutes. Meal prep on the weekend saves a lot of time during the week.

Opt for healthy convenience products like ready-made salads or protein bars when you're short on time. It's important that exercise and nutrition still remain a part of your daily routine.
